Dispelling Common Myths
One of the initial hurdles in understanding senior living is the prevalence of myths. Many people in India view community living with skepticism, often
associating it with abandonment or a lack of familial care. It's often mistakenly perceived as a last resort, a place for those without family support. This perception clashes with the modern reality, where senior living communities offer a vibrant alternative, providing independence, social engagement, and a supportive environment. Another significant myth revolves around the loss of autonomy. Some fear that moving into a community means giving up control over one's life, daily routines, and personal choices. In truth, many communities are designed to foster independence, offering a range of services from housekeeping to healthcare, allowing residents to tailor their lives to their preferences. The narrative that senior living is expensive is also a common misconception. While costs vary, depending on the amenities and services, many communities offer a range of options to fit different budgets. Furthermore, when factoring in the costs of independent living, such as home maintenance, utilities, and healthcare, the overall expense of community living can be comparable and in some cases, even more affordable. By challenging these misconceptions, we can pave the way for a more informed and nuanced understanding of senior living options.

Benefits of Community Living
The advantages of senior living extend beyond mere convenience, encompassing multiple facets of well-being. One of the primary benefits is the enhanced social life that these communities provide. Living among peers creates opportunities for social interaction, reducing feelings of isolation and loneliness. Activities such as group outings, hobby clubs, and shared meals create a vibrant and supportive environment, promoting mental and emotional health. Another critical advantage is the availability of on-site healthcare services. Communities often have dedicated medical staff, ensuring residents have access to regular check-ups, medication management, and immediate care when needed. This can alleviate the stress of arranging healthcare and provide peace of mind for both residents and their families. Safety and security are also significant factors. Senior living communities typically have enhanced security measures, providing a safe and protected environment. This can be especially valuable for seniors who may be living alone or have concerns about their physical safety. Furthermore, these communities often handle the burdens of home maintenance, such as landscaping, repairs, and housekeeping. This allows residents to spend their time pursuing their interests and enjoying their lives, without the stress of managing household tasks. Ultimately, the benefits of senior living support an improved quality of life, allowing seniors to age gracefully, engage socially, and maintain their independence.
The Future of Aging
The future of senior living in India is shaped by the country's aging population and evolving needs. There's a growing demand for communities that cater to diverse requirements, ranging from independent living to assisted care. We can anticipate more specialized communities that focus on specific health needs, such as dementia care or rehabilitation services. Innovations in technology are also set to play a significant role. Smart home features, telemedicine, and digital communication tools will enhance safety, convenience, and connectivity for residents. The concept of 'aging in place' will likely gain prominence, with communities designed to adapt to residents' changing needs, allowing them to remain in the same environment even as their health requirements evolve. Furthermore, there's a growing emphasis on holistic well-being. Communities are expected to incorporate wellness programs focusing on physical, mental, and emotional health. This will include fitness centers, recreational activities, and mental health support.
